The Brooks County Trojans will face off against the Turner County Titans at 7:00 p.m. on Tuesday. Turner County took a loss in their last match and will be looking to turn the tables on Brooks County, who comes in off a win.
Brooks County's defense heads into the contest hoping to repeat the dominance they displayed on Thursday. Everything went their way against Lanier County as Brooks County made off with a 9-0 victory. The result was nothing new for the Trojans, who have now won four games by three goals or more so far this season.
Meanwhile, Turner County lost 5-1 to Echols County on Thursday. The Titans haven't had much luck with the Wildcats recently, as the team has come up short the last six times they've met.
Brooks County's win was their third straight at home, which pushed their record up to 4-1. The wins came thanks in part to their defensive effort, having only given up one goal over those three matches. As for Turner County, their loss dropped their record down to 0-2.
Everything went Brooks County's way against Turner County in their previous meeting back in March of 2024, as Brooks County made off with an 11-1 victory. In that contest, Brooks County amassed a halftime lead of 6-1, an impressive feat they'll look to repeat on Tuesday.
